Anything with a non-zero mass can never reach c (speed of light in a vacuum). Anything with a zero mass can only travel at c (speed of light in a vacuum). Photons, the particles of light, have zero mass.
That said things with a non-zero mass can travel faster than the speed of things with a zero mass, when they are traveling in a medium (e.g. air, water, glass, diamond). However when they do so they emit Cherenkov Radiation (usually a blue to violet glow) in their direction of travel. This is very loosely the light equivalent of the sonic boom shockwave when something travels faster than the speed of sound in a medium. This radiation eventually slows them down.
No, the speed of light cannot be accurately measured by the naked eye. While humans can observe the effects of light, such as seeing a flash or a distant object, our perception is not precise enough to measure the speed of light. Accurate measurements require specialized equipment, such as lasers and high-speed cameras, to capture and analyze light's behavior.

No, it is not possible to travel at the speed of light in water. Light travels at a slower speed in water compared to its speed in a vacuum, which is about 299,792 kilometers per second. The speed of light in water is approximately 225,000 kilometers per second.

The speed of light is nearly a million times faster than the speed of sound.The speed of light is roughly 882 thousand times the speed of sound.-- Sound takes about 4.7 seconds to cover 1 mile.-- Light takes about 0.0000054 second to cover 1 mile.-- In the time it takes sound to travel one mile, light travels 881,741 miles .
